Laptop fever Source

Because the power consumption and heat consumption of the desktop CPU are relatively large, using it in the notebook will lead to some unpleasant things in the notebook due to poor heat dissipation, so the mobile processor specially designed for the notebook is born. Many notebook CPU processors consume more than 20 W of power, especially the mobile Pentium 4 processor. Although many technologies make the average energy consumption of the entire notebook very low, however, the peak value during use is still very high, with more than 30 million organic resources. Much of the energy consumed will become heat-emitting.

The main heat dissipation of the notebook is of course from the CPU, which is a hot user. However, in the notebook, the CPU heat is not the whole notebook heat. In addition, the CPU processor heat is not very large in the early days. Simply using a simple passive heat dissipation method can satisfy the heat dissipation needs of the machine, that is, the heat sink that everyone is familiar. However, with the continuous upgrade of the CPU processor, the heat dissipation demand of the processor is very urgent after the Pentium III processor era.

Second, the video card heat also accounts for a large proportion, the early video card heat is not very large, however, many high-end machines often configure good graphics such as ATI mobility radeon 9600 or geforce 4 5600 go, so the heat also increases a lot. Then, some other hot accessories, such as memory, hard disk, and battery, are also some sources of notebook heat.

Introduction to notebook Heat Dissipation

1. Fan cooling. Currently, one of the heat dissipation methods of many laptops is caused by fan cooling. The fan is divided into two types: axial fan and radial fan. In general, the axial fan, the cost is low, the air volume can be adjusted as needed, but the occupied volume is relatively large, it is impossible to make the notebook very thin. The other radiation fan has thin blades, good airflow direction, no eddy current, and small footprint. However, the cost is relatively high, but most laptops are widely used, mainly considering reducing the size of the notebook.

2. heat pipe heat dissipation. Heat Pipe Cooling was initially introduced by IBM. Because the heat pipe is more suitable for machines with small volume space, short time heat dissipation, and small space near the heat source, heat pipe cooling technology is increasingly used in laptops.

3. Double fan cooling. Such a heat dissipation method often appears on some machines with strong performance. A fan must be used to heat the CPU, the other is to heat the data in different places based on different machine conditions. Some machines heat the graphics card, and some machines still serve the CPU. The dual-fan design saves power, because a single fan must use high power, and the dual-fan does not need to, so that noise can be reduced. The CPU uses a dual-fan, which only requires a low-power fan and runs Based on the heat, resulting in lower noise and prolonged service life.

4. Heat Dissipation through the machine itself. Some ultra-thin machines cannot install the fan for heat dissipation due to their own volume restrictions, so they use their own components for heat dissipation, use the keyboard to assist in heat dissipation and the machine metal shell to distribute the internal heat of the machine.

External Auxiliary Heat Dissipation Products

Although there are already good auxiliary heat sink devices in the notebook, many laptops will still undergo severe tests in the hot summer. Some machines will suffer from excessive heat, and a "miserable event" such as burning CPU ". Therefore, if we can add external Auxiliary Heat Dissipation products, we believe that our book will surely survive a cool summer.

Currently, there are not many laptop heat dissipation products on the market. Generally, we can see such products as the fan base for the notebook and the liquid Heat Sink base for the notebook.

The price of the fan base for the notebook is relatively low in the heat dissipation products of the notebook, which can be bought in dozens of Yuan. It is powered by a USB interface. There are two fans on the base. Connect the power source and plug in the USB cable. The fan will start to run, so that the notebook and the desktop can be isolated, use a fan to distribute the heat at the bottom of the notebook to the space of the base, so that you can avoid the heat conduction of the notebook on the table, without causing the bottom of the notebook to be very hot.

Notebook dedicated Liquid Heat Sink base: This type of heat sink base is expensive in terms of price, generally around 100 yuan, it through the dedicated coolant inside, quickly absorb the heat at the bottom of the notebook, let the heat be quickly distributed out in a short time.
